Government Affairs

Led by Deputy Executive Director Tom Curtis, staff at AWWA's Government Affairs Office in Washington, D.C., attend to legislative and regulatory actions that impact water utilities in the United States.

  • The Washington staff closely coordinates its many activities with the Water Utility Council. Together they develop action programs to initiate, evaluate, respond, and comment within the framework of AWWA policy, on legislative, regulatory, and other matters which directly affect water utilities.
  • AWWA's Government Affairs Office keeps current lists of state and federal contacts, assists in framing legislation, and helps members strategically position and explain issues to regulatory agencies.
  • Through the annual member Fly In, the office also helps members locate and meet with officials and other regulators, legislators, health organizations, and public policy makers.

Through these and other efforts, AWWA works to ensure the safety of public water supplies while minimizing the financial burden on utilities and their customers.
